What exactly is a split bedroom floor plan? In a property with a split bedroom floor plan, the main bedroom or suite is separated from the rest of the rooms in the house. So you'll have the main bedroom on one end of the house, then the common living spaces in the middle, and the other bedrooms grouped together on the other side of the house. Split bedroom floor plans create privacy and peaceful separation by placing the primary suite on the opposite side of the home from other bedrooms. This thoughtful design positions the main living areas - typically the great room, kitchen, and dining space - between the sleeping quarters, acting as a natural buffer zone. A house with a split bedroom plan usually features eating and living areas designed with an open plan concept. It makes the house appear and feel more functional, spacious, and comfortable. However, the isolated location of the master bedroom is what makes a split bedroom plan unique and different from the other house plans.
